22-08-2022
|
Miembro
|
|
Registrado: dic 2021
Posts: 11
Reputación: 0
|
|
Cita:
Empezado por GorkaB
Buenas,
A ver si alguien me puede echar un cable por favor. No he tenido problemas de envío a Bizkaia ni a Gipuzkoa pero al enviar a Araba la respuesta siempre es " Certificado remitente incorrecto (revocado o no homologado)".
He probado con certificados activos de producción de izenpe siguiendo las indicaciones del servicio de asistencia de Araba y no hay manera. No sé lo que estoy haciendo mal y ellos tampoco parece ser.
Envío el xml firmado con cURL:
Código PHP:
curl_setopt($soap_do, CURLOPT_URL, 'https...no tengo permiso para poner enlaces ... pruebas-ticketbai.araba.eus/TicketBAI/v1/facturas/'); curl_setopt($soap_do, CURLOPT_CONNECTTIMEOUT, 500); curl_setopt($soap_do, CURLOPT_TIMEOUT, 500); curl_setopt($soap_do, CURLOPT_RETURNTRANSFER, 1); curl_setopt($soap_do, CURLOPT_HEADER, 1); curl_setopt($soap_do, CURLOPT_FOLLOWLOCATION, 1); curl_setopt($soap_do,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t($soap_do, CURLOPT_SSL_VERIFYHOST, 0); curl_setopt($soap_do, CURLOPT_USERAGENT, 'Mozilla/4.0 (compatible; MSIE 5.01; Windows NT 5.0)'); curl_setopt($soap_do, CURLOPT_POST, 1); curl_setopt($soap_do, CURLOPT_SSLCERT, $this->url_cert); curl_setopt($soap_do, CURLOPT_SSLKEY, $this->url_key); curl_setopt($soap_do, CURLOPT_POSTFIELDS, $xml_firmado); curl_setopt($soap_do, CURLOPT_HTTPHEADER, array("Content-Type: application/xml","charset=UTF-8");
Por otro lado: ¿Alguien sabe si es posible hacer consultas en Gipuzkoa y Araba como en Bizkaia?
Muchas gracias de antemano
|
Me respondo a mi mismo porque era un fallo en mi programación. Estaba firmando con el certificado correcto pero enviando con el certificado incorrecto.
Queda pendiente el tema de las consultas que creo que no se puede.
Gracias de nuevo
|